The Antarctic Survey Telescopes (AST3, http://aag.bao.ac.cn/ast3/) consist of three 50/68cm modified Schmidt telescopes, equipped with 10k x 10k STA1600FT CCD cameras. The AST3 telescopes were designed for multi-band wide-field astronomical surveys at Dome A, Antarctica with a field-of-view of 4.3 square degrees. The first AST3 (AST3-1) was deployed to Dome A, Antarctica by the 28th Chinese Antarctic Research Expedition (CHINARE) team in January 2012, and became the largest optical telescope in Antarctica. AST3-1 started operation in mid March 2012, when the polar day ended, but unfortunately stopped working on 8 May 2012 due to some malfunction in the power supply system. Until then, AST3-1 had repeatedly surveyed nearly 2,000 deg^2 to search SNe with more than 3,000 60-sec exposures, and monitored several fields, including the center of the Large Magellanic Cloud with greater than 4,700 frames, a field in the Galactic disk for exoplanet transit surveying with greater than 3,000 frames, and the Wolf-Rayet star HD 143414 with greater than 1,000 frames. The data were retrieved by the 29th CHINARE team in April 2013, then have been processed by the Antarctic Astronomy Group at NAOC. AST3-1 was supported by UNSW's PLATO observatory infrastructure. The data are available here: http://explore.china-vo.org/?locale=en and are described in the following peer-reviewed paper: Ma, B., Shang, Z., Hu, Y., Hu, K., Liu, Q., Ashley, M. C. B., Cui, X., Du, F., Fan, D., Feng, L., Huang, F., Gu, B., He, B., Ji, T., Li, X., Li, Z., Liu, H., Tian, Q., Tao, C., Wang, D., Wang, L., Wang, S., Wang, X., Wei, P., Wu, J., Xu, L., Yang, S., Yang, M., Yang, Y., Yu, C., Yuan, X., Zhou, H., Zhang, H., Zhang, X., Zhang, Y., Zhao, C., Zhou, J., Zhu, Z.-H., 2018, The first release of the AST3-1 Point Source Catalogue from Dome A, Antarctica, MNRAS, 479, 111–120., doi:10.1093/mnras/sty1392, Sep/2018
